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12092 34780 786 617706
338147 71206040 41568773
338147 71206040 41568773
26790554208 459902 886 24642
All about undefined
Interested in learning more?
338147 71206040 41568773
26790554208 459902 886 24642
See more
06 90
4421847533 4343144 88240957479
See more
142032591 5741093 94
516318 9995306792 5258
See more